How Aptiwise Helps
Access requests, infrastructure changes, and asset lifecycle events all route through the same governance engine — with every decision permanently recorded.
System and data access requests flow through owner approval and an explicit acknowledgement step before anything is granted — turning your access-control policy into the only path to actually getting access. The same engine reaches SaaS, legacy, on-prem, and non-API systems.
Cron-triggered checks scan your DigitalOcean and GCP infrastructure on a schedule. When a resource changes outside expected state, it doesn't just get logged — it routes to the right owner for sign-off.
Equipment requests, registration, and retirement all go through approval and land in a single registry. A dedicated check flags assets with no current owner before they become an audit finding.
Every submission, approval, rejection, and escalation is written to a SHA-256 hash-chained audit log — each entry links to the last, so any tampering breaks the chain and is immediately detectable.
